The essentials at a glance

Detail🇮🇩 Bali🇯🇵 Sapporo
Population~4.4 million (island of Bali)≈1.96 million in the city — about a third of everyone in Hokkaido, in one place
Official languageIndonesian (Balinese spoken locally; English in tourist areas)Japanese, close to the standard register with Hokkaido vocabulary rather than a strong accent. English is limited outside the university and the ski resorts
CurrencyIndonesian Rupiah (IDR)Japanese yen (JPY)
Time zoneWITA (GMT+8)JST (GMT+9) — one time zone for the whole country, and no daylight saving despite the northern latitude
Power plugTypes C/F, 230VType A and B, 100 V at 50 Hz — Hokkaido is on the eastern grid, unlike Osaka and Nagoya at 60 Hz
ReligionBalinese Hindu (unique in Muslim-majority Indonesia)
ClimateHumid continental — no June rainy season and almost no typhoons, mild dry summers, and roughly 4.8 metres of cumulative snowfall each winter
Driving sideLeft. The 1990 spike tyre law ended manufacture and sale and prohibits studded tyres in designated areas, Sapporo among them; studless winter tyres are the only practical option here
AddressesA numbered grid counted north, south, east and west from Ōdōri — the only major Japanese city where an address is self-explanatory
